About Vollpension

Unique generational cafe in MuseumsQuartier where elderly women bake homemade cakes using their own recipes, served in a cozy living-room setting with mismatched vintage furniture. The cake selection changes daily based on what the grandmothers baked, with prices around EUR 5.50 per slice and excellent coffee for EUR 3.80. A social enterprise providing income for pensioners.

Insider Tips

The Nussstrudel is only available Wednesdays and Saturdays when Oma Margarete bakes; arrive before 3 PM as it sells out.
